Anti-oxidation copper rod and preparation method thereof

By coating and curing the anti-oxidation coating liquid on the surface of the copper rod, utilizing the reaction of mercapto silicone oil with 4-allylcatechol and eugenol to form a stable molecular structure, and combining it with nano-yttrium oxide and nano-tantalum oxide fillers, the problem of insufficient anti-oxidation performance of the copper rod is solved, achieving efficient anti-oxidation effect and comprehensive performance improvement.

The present application relates to the field of metal coating technology, and specifically discloses an antioxidant copper rod and a preparation method thereof. The preparation method of the antioxidant copper rod of the present application comprises the following steps: applying an antioxidant coating liquid to the surface of the copper rod, and then performing a heat curing treatment to form an antioxidant film on the surface of the copper rod; the antioxidant coating liquid comprises the following raw materials in parts by weight: 100 parts of epoxy resin, 20-30 parts of antioxidant, 15-20 parts of filler, 1-10 parts of anti-ultraviolet agent, 5-10 parts of curing agent, 1-5 parts of leveling agent, and 20-40 parts of solvent; and the silicon chain structure of the antioxidant contains thiol and phenolic hydroxyl groups. The obtained antioxidant coating liquid can form an excellent antioxidant film on the surface of the copper rod, effectively extending the service life of the copper rod, improving its comprehensive performance, meeting the high-quality and high-performance requirements of copper rods in different industries, and has broad market prospects.

Technical Field

[0001] The present application relates to the technical field of metal coatings, and more specifically, to an oxidation-resistant copper rod and a preparation method thereof. Background Art

[0002] In modern industrial production, copper rod, as a fundamental metal material, has been widely used in numerous fields, including electricity, electronics, and construction, thanks to its excellent electrical and thermal conductivity and processing properties. From the manufacture of cables for power transmission, to the precision components of electronic devices, to water supply and drainage pipes in the construction industry, copper rod plays an indispensable role.

[0003] However, copper rods currently on the market generally suffer from poor oxidation resistance. Copper easily reacts chemically with oxygen in air, forming copper rust. This rust not only affects the copper rod's appearance, causing it to lose its luster and develop mottled rust marks, but more seriously, it significantly degrades its performance. On the one hand, the presence of copper rust increases the copper rod's electrical resistance, thereby affecting its conductivity, reducing power transmission efficiency, and increasing energy loss. In power systems, this can lead to increased voltage drop, wasted energy, and even pose safety risks. On the other hand, copper rust weakens the copper rod's mechanical strength, making it more susceptible to breakage during processing and use, reducing product reliability and service life.

[0004] As various industries continue to increase their requirements for the quality and performance of copper rods, various industries have put forward increasingly higher requirements for the quality and performance of copper rods. However, due to insufficient oxidation resistance, existing copper rods can no longer meet the growing market demand. Therefore, the present application provides an oxidation-resistant copper rod and a preparation method thereof. Summary of the Invention

[0005] In order to solve the problem that the existing copper rod has poor anti-oxidation effect, the present application provides an anti-oxidation copper rod and a preparation method thereof.

[0006] In a first aspect, the present application provides a method for preparing an oxidation-resistant copper rod, which adopts the following technical solution:

[0007] A method for preparing an oxidation-resistant copper rod comprises the following steps:

[0008] After coating the anti-oxidation coating liquid on the surface of the copper rod, heating and curing treatment is performed to form an anti-oxidation film on the surface of the copper rod;

[0009] The anti-oxidation coating liquid comprises the following raw materials in parts by weight: 100 parts of epoxy resin, 20-30 parts of antioxidant, 15-20 parts of filler, 1-10 parts of anti-ultraviolet agent, 5-10 parts of curing agent, 1-5 parts of leveling agent, and 20-40 parts of solvent.

[0010] Preferably, the method for preparing the antioxidant comprises the following steps:

[0011] S1. Add octamethylcyclotetrasiloxane, 3-mercaptopropylmethyldimethoxysilane, hexamethyldisiloxane, and concentrated sulfuric acid to water, stir evenly at room temperature, and react in an oil bath at 60-70°C under nitrogen protection for 8-12 hours. Cool to room temperature, add excess calcium hydroxide to the reaction solution to neutralize the concentrated sulfuric acid, filter, add excess anhydrous magnesium sulfate to the obtained filtrate, dry it, filter with suction, and rotary evaporate to obtain mercapto silicone oil;

[0012] S2. Add the mercapto silicone oil, 4-allylcatechol, eugenol, and benzophenone obtained in step S1 to toluene, mix them evenly, irradiate them under ultraviolet light for 1-3 hours, concentrate them under reduced pressure, wash them, add anhydrous magnesium sulfate to dry them, filter them, and rotary evaporate them to obtain an antioxidant.

[0013] Preferably, the mass ratio of octamethylcyclotetrasiloxane, 3-mercaptopropylmethyldimethoxysilane, hexamethyldisiloxane, concentrated sulfuric acid and water in step S1 is (59-65) g: (36-40) g: (16-20) g: (1.6-2) g: (200-400) g.

[0014] Preferably, the mass ratio of mercapto silicone oil, 4-allylcatechol, eugenol, benzophenone and toluene in step S2 is (50-60) g: (7.5-8) g: (8-8.5) g: (1-1.5) g: (200-400) g.

[0015] Preferably, the filler is obtained by mixing nano-yttrium oxide and nano-tantalum oxide in a mass ratio of 3:(1-7).

[0016] Preferably, the anti-ultraviolet agent is at least one of UV-320, UV-531, UV-328, UV-1130, UV-326, UV-123, and UV-400.

[0017] Preferably, the curing agent is at least one of maleic anhydride, phthalic anhydride, m-phenylenediamine, diethylenetriamine, ethylenediamine, and phenylenediamine.

[0018] Preferably, the leveling agent is at least one of BYK-333, BYK-332, and BYK-3560.

[0019] Preferably, the solvent is at least one of ethanol, butanone, xylene, and ethylene glycol monobutyl ether.

[0022] In summary, this application has the following beneficial effects:

[0023] 1. The antioxidant film on the surface of the copper rod of the present application is formed by heating and curing an antioxidant coating liquid. The antioxidant coating liquid includes epoxy resin, antioxidant, filler, anti-ultraviolet agent, curing agent, leveling agent, and solvent. The components interact with each other, and the resulting copper rod has excellent antioxidant properties, effectively extending the service life of the copper rod, improving its comprehensive performance, and meeting the high-quality and high-performance requirements of copper rods in different industries.

[0024] 2. In the preparation process of the antioxidant of the present application, first, under the catalysis of concentrated sulfuric acid, the siloxy bond of octamethylcyclotetrasiloxane undergoes a ring-opening reaction, and at the same time, the methoxy group of 3-mercaptopropylmethyldimethoxysilane is hydrolyzed to generate a hydroxyl group; the ring-opened octamethylcyclotetrasiloxane and the hydrolyzed 3-mercaptopropylmethyldimethoxysilane are connected through a condensation reaction of the siloxy bond, and the siloxy bond in hexamethyldisiloxane is broken and connected to one end of the polymer chain to obtain mercapto silicone oil. The siloxy bond in the mercapto silicone oil has a high bond energy and stable chemical properties, which can provide a stable skeleton for the entire antioxidant molecule. The framework structure can ensure that the antioxidant can maintain the integrity of its molecules under various complex environmental conditions, thereby continuously exerting its antioxidant effect; then the mercapto group in the mercapto silicone oil can react with the carbon-carbon double bond in 4-allylcatechol and eugenol under the action of the initiator to produce a thiol click reaction to obtain antioxidants. The molecules of 4-allylcatechol and eugenol contain multiple phenolic hydroxyl groups with hydrogen-donating capabilities. In the antioxidant process, the phenolic hydroxyl groups can provide hydrogen atoms to combine with free radicals, converting the free radicals into stable molecules, thereby interrupting the free radical chain reaction and achieving the purpose of antioxidant.

[0025] The antioxidant of the present application greatly enhances the antioxidant effect of the antioxidant due to its stable molecular structure and synergistic effect of multiple functional groups, enabling it to more effectively remove various types of free radicals and protect the copper rod from oxidative damage.

[0026] 3. The filler of this application is a mixture of nano-yttrium oxide and nano-tantalum oxide. When evenly dispersed in an antioxidant coating solution and coated on the surface of a copper rod to form a thin film, it can be tightly arranged to form a dense, continuous protective layer. The nano-yttrium oxide and nano-tantalum oxide synergistically interact with the antioxidant to enhance its antioxidant effect. On the one hand, the surface of the nanomaterial can adsorb antioxidant molecules, making the antioxidant more evenly distributed in the coating and improving its utilization rate. On the other hand, the nano-yttrium oxide and nano-tantalum oxide also affect the electronic structure of the antioxidant molecules, enhancing the hydrogen-donating capacity of the phenolic hydroxyl and thiol groups, thereby more effectively enhancing the antioxidant properties of the copper rod.

[0027] 4. DETAILED DESCRIPTION

[0028] The present application is further described in detail below with reference to the embodiments.

[0029] Examples 1-5 provide a method for preparing an oxidation-resistant copper rod.

[0030] Example 1:

[0031] A method for preparing an oxidation-resistant copper rod comprises the following steps:

[0032] Step (1) Preparation of antioxidant

[0033] S1. Add 59 g of octamethylcyclotetrasiloxane, 36 g of 3-mercaptopropylmethyldimethoxysilane, 16 g of hexamethyldisiloxane, and 1.6 g of concentrated sulfuric acid (98 wt%) to 200 g of water, stir evenly at room temperature, and react in an oil bath at 60 ° C for 8 h under nitrogen protection. Cool to room temperature, add excess calcium hydroxide to the reaction solution to neutralize the concentrated sulfuric acid, filter, add excess anhydrous magnesium sulfate to the obtained filtrate, dry it, filter it with suction, and rotary evaporate to obtain mercapto silicone oil;

[0034] S2. Add 50 g of the mercaptosilicone oil obtained in step S1, 7.5 g of 4-allylcatechol, 8 g of eugenol, and 1 g of benzophenone to 200 g of toluene, mix them evenly, irradiate them under ultraviolet light for 1 hour, concentrate them under reduced pressure, wash them, add anhydrous magnesium sulfate to dry them, filter them with suction, and evaporate them by rotary evaporation to obtain an antioxidant;

[0035] Step (2) Preparation of antioxidant coating liquid

[0036] By weight, 100 parts of epoxy resin, 20 parts of antioxidant, 15 parts of filler, 1 part of anti-ultraviolet agent, 5 parts of curing agent, 1 part of leveling agent, and 20 parts of solvent were mixed uniformly to obtain an antioxidant coating liquid;

[0037] The epoxy resin is E-51; the filler is a mixture of nano-yttrium oxide and nano-tantalum oxide in a mass ratio of 3:1; the anti-ultraviolet agent is UV-320; the curing agent is maleic anhydride; the leveling agent is BYK-333; and the solvent is ethanol.

[0038] Step (3) Preparation of Anti-Oxidation Copper Rod

[0039] After the anti-oxidation coating liquid is coated on the surface of the copper rod, it is heated and cured at a temperature of 100° C. and a pressure of 2 MPa for 2 hours to form an anti-oxidation film on the surface of the copper rod, thereby obtaining an anti-oxidation copper rod.

[0133] The comprehensive properties of the antioxidant copper rods obtained in Examples 1-5 of the present application and Comparative Examples 1-5 were tested respectively, and the test results are shown in Table 1 below.

[0134] (1) According to GB / T1865-1997 “Paints and varnishes - Artificial weathering and artificial radiation exposure”, the antioxidant copper rods prepared in Examples 1-5 and Comparative Examples 1-5 were subjected to an artificial weathering test for 1500 hours;

[0135] (2) The antioxidant copper rods prepared in Examples 1-5 and Comparative Examples 1-5 were kept at 200°C for 15 minutes, and then subjected to a hot-cold alternating test. After 150 cycles, the rods were tested for cracks. The rods were then kept at 250°C for 15 minutes, and then subjected to a hot-cold alternating test. After 50 cycles, the rods were tested for cracks. The rods were then kept at 300°C for 15 minutes, and then subjected to a hot-cold alternating test. After 30 cycles, the rods were tested for cracks.

[0136] (3) The water resistance (25°C, 300h) of the antioxidant copper rods prepared in Examples 1-5 and Comparative Examples 1-5 was tested in accordance with GB 5209-1985 “Determination of water resistance of paints and varnishes - Immersion method”. The test standard was no blistering and no rusting.

[0139] It can be seen from the data shown in Table 1 above that the antioxidant films on the surfaces of the antioxidant copper rods obtained in Examples 1-5 have better adhesion, denser structure, and greater durability than those in Comparative Examples 1-5. They have excellent antioxidant properties, high temperature resistance, and water resistance, are green and environmentally friendly, and have broad market prospects.

[0140] The antioxidant coating liquid used for the copper rod in Example 1 contains 4-allylcatechol and eugenol as the raw materials for preparing the antioxidant. Compared with Comparative Examples 1 and 2, it is fully demonstrated that the interaction between 4-allylcatechol and eugenol leads to synergistic effect, which greatly improves the antioxidant performance of the copper rod.

[0141] The antioxidant coating liquid used for the copper rod in Example 1, the raw materials for preparing the antioxidant include octamethylcyclotetrasiloxane, 3-mercaptopropylmethyldimethoxysilane, hexamethyldisiloxane, 4-allylcatechol and eugenol. Compared with Comparative Example 3, it is fully demonstrated that the antioxidant of the present application can significantly enhance the antioxidant properties of the copper rod.

[0142] The antioxidant coating liquid used for the copper rod in Example 1 has a filler obtained by mixing nano-yttrium oxide and nano-tantalum oxide. Compared with Comparative Examples 4 and 5, it is fully demonstrated that nano-yttrium oxide and nano-tantalum oxide synergistically enhance the antioxidant performance, high temperature resistance and water resistance of the copper rod.
